THE ORGANS OF ADHESION IN THE APHID MEGOURA VICIAE
The Journal of Experimental Biology, (1988)
Abstract
Summary 1. The anatomy of the adhesive organs is described in Megoura viciae Buckton. The claws serve as grappling hooks which are locked in position by the retractor unguis tendon.
